>With Cr+book verses Cr-book - I think the answer is obvious = cr+book will do
>better - but cr+book vs Ya-book or Cr-book vs Ya+book - does the book help there
>?  Intution and experience says yes - but by how much is it 100 points - is it
>more than 100 points - I don't know.
>
>So now that I am interested in this question , I just completed 100 games @ 2 6
>where Yace scored 51% vs Crafty 17.16 SE 49% - both with books.
>
>The second round is 100 games Ya+book vs Cr-book @ 2 6.

>The third round is 100 games Ya-book vs Cr+book.
>
>The fourth round is 100 games Ya+book vs Ya-book.
>
>The fifth round is 100 games Cr+book vs Cr-book
>==================================================================
>Below are test rounds where we know the expected result is 50% in attempt to
>gauge the randomness of results with book vs without book.  You would think
>without book would be very close to 50%.  With book we might see more
>variability in results - but perhaps not as large as above.
>==================================================================
>The sixth round is 100 games Ya+book vs Ya+book (it should be 50%)
>
>The seventh round is 100 games Cr+book vs Cr+book (it should be 50%)
>
>The sixth round is 100 games Ya-book vs Ya-book (it should be 50%)
>
>The seventh round is 100 games Cr-book vs Cr-book (it should be 50%)
